3 held for scamming people with forged Kuwaiti visas

The Detective Branch of police arrested three persons for scamming people by forging Kuwaiti visas and Bureau of Manpower, Emplo­yment and Training cards through fake Facebook pages.

The arrested are – Shariful Islam, Abrar Jawar Tanmoy alias Rezaul Karim Reza alias Hridi Mahajabin and Ahian Shishir alias Kamruzzaman Shishir.They were arrested from Bandarban’s Naikhong­chhari and Dhaka’s Vatara area on Friday. Briefing media, Dhaka metropolitan police DB chief Harun-or-Rashid said that the group had scammed about Tk1.35 crore from over 50 victims.

The ring created Facebook pages using fake IDs and tempted people for Kuwaiti visas with jobs there for handsome salary. Those who applied through them got into a contract in exchange of a hefty amount of money, said Harun.

Then they arrange training and BMET clearance card with fake visas using original visa information and numbers. After showing the air tickets to job aspirants, they embezzled the full amount of money and then switched off their phone numbers to go into hiding.

The DB seized 40 passports, nine forged visas, photocopies of fake BMET cards, along with mobile phones and sim cards used in fraudulence from their possessions.

The DB chief said that the fraud ring rented an office under the name of Al-Safar International at Gulshan-1. Using the address of the said office, they opened pages on Facebook with various pseudonyms. There, they attract the attention of people luring them of high-paying jobs in Kuwait.

A victim filed a case with Gulshan police station on August 7.

‘There are four cases against Shariful and one case against Tanmoy over money embezzlement in different police stations,’ the DB official said.

According to the investigators, Tanmoy and Shishir are both transgender persons. For the purpose of cheating, they changed their genders to assume the identity of Hridi Mahazabin to Abrar Jawar Tanmoy alias Rezaul Karim Reza and Sharmin to Kamruzzaman Shishir.

Their true identities were recovered after a thorough investigation by the DB, they said.
